Today I had my 39 week appointment with my doctor. Things were about the same...still dilated to only a 2. It's been this way for 2 weeks now. But, today was different. When they took my blood pressure, the nurse responds, "That's high for you." And takes it again. A little lower the second time but still higher than normal. So, I go through the normal checkup procedure of peeing in a cup, etc. Then the doctor comes in (unusually faster than normal). He measures, checks for head down, intently checks heart rate, and checks for dilation. As we sit up he says, "Let's get you dressed and we'll talk." This of course is not normal because usually everything is fine. So about 5 minutes later, my doc comes back obviously concerned. He asks if my blood pressure went up at the end of my first pregnancy. It had not. He started expressing concern that my blood pressure had risen and also they had found more protein in the urine. I guess these are two warning signs of preeclampsia. As we talked, I also mentioned that for about 2 weeks I had constant swelling in my legs, feet, and hands...another sign for preeclampsia. So, seeing the worry on his face, they talked about rest, but let's be serious, how much rest could I get with a 2 year old. So then when he mentioned induction, I thought this was find because it's so close now. He called the hospital and set up an induction at 6 a.m. Thursday, March 3. So, we're getting this baby out.
